Wayland Man Facing Drug Charges From Hornell Police
From Hornell Police: A six-month investigation into illicit drug sales in the City of Hornell resulted in the arrest of Brian T. Hess, age 40, of 10 S. Main St. Wayland NY. Mr. Hess was arrested via Steuben County Superior Court Warrant at approximately 9:45am Saturday morning and was charged with 3 counts of Criminal Possession of a Controlled Substance in the Third Degree (B Felony) and 3 counts of Criminal Sale of a Controlled Substance (B Felony). Hess was transferred to Steuben County Central Arraignment Part Court to answer the charges. The investigation was led by Sgt. Tom Aini of the Hornell Police Department with assistance from the Steuben County District Attorney’s Office and the Steuben County Sheriff’s Office.

Several departments battle large barn fire in Riga
Riga, N.Y. - Dozens of firefighters responded to a second-alarm barn fire Tuesday night. Crews said it started in a trailer just before 7 p.m., and spread to the barn next to it on Chili-Riga Center Road. Units said the heat outside forced them to call in some extra manpower.

NY State Police make vehicular manslaughter arrest stemming from November 2020 crash
One vehicle accident in the town of Grove NY claimed the life of Brian J. Hitchcock of Liverpool NY. The patience of law enforcement was displayed this week with the arrest of William Hitchcock Jr., age 48 of Livonia NY. Hitchcock was charged with one count of felony vehicular manslaughter with a blood alcohol content over .18%, after over two years of investigation. Hitchcock was the driver of a pickup truck that went off the road in the northern Allegany County town of Grove on November 28, 2020. Brian J. Hitchcock, age 43, of Liverpool NY was pronounced dead at the scene.
